Searched refs:FieldAlign (Results 1 – 3 of 3) sorted by relevance
/netbsd/external/apache2/llvm/dist/clang/lib/AST/ |
H A D | RecordLayoutBuilder.cpp | 1612 FieldAlign = 1; in LayoutBitField() 1632 FieldAlign = 32; in LayoutBitField() 1662 FieldAlign = 1; in LayoutBitField() 1668 FieldAlign = std::max(FieldAlign, ZeroLengthBitfieldBoundary); in LayoutBitField() 1672 FieldAlign = 1; in LayoutBitField() 1681 FieldAlign = 1; in LayoutBitField() 1686 FieldAlign = std::max(FieldAlign, ExplicitFieldAlign); in LayoutBitField() 1698 FieldAlign = std::min(FieldAlign, MaxFieldAlignmentInBits); in LayoutBitField() 1881 CharUnits FieldAlign; in LayoutField() local 2004 FieldAlign = std::max(FieldAlign, MaxAlignmentInChars); in LayoutField() [all …]
|
H A D | ASTContext.cpp | 1779 unsigned FieldAlign = toBits(Layout.getAlignment()); in getDeclAlign() local 1787 if (LowBitOfOffset < FieldAlign) in getDeclAlign() 1788 FieldAlign = static_cast<unsigned>(LowBitOfOffset); in getDeclAlign() 1791 Align = std::min(Align, FieldAlign); in getDeclAlign()
|
/netbsd/external/apache2/llvm/dist/clang/lib/CodeGen/ |
H A D | CGDebugInfo.cpp | 1186 uint32_t FieldAlign = CGM.getContext().getTypeAlign(Ty); in collectDefaultElementTypesForBlockPointer() local 1188 Unit, "__descriptor", nullptr, LineNo, FieldSize, FieldAlign, in collectDefaultElementTypesForBlockPointer() 2788 uint32_t FieldAlign = 0; in CreateTypeDefinition() local 2796 FieldAlign = getTypeAlignIfRequired(FType, CGM.getContext()); in CreateTypeDefinition() 3522 auto FieldAlign = getTypeAlignIfRequired(FType, CGM.getContext()); in CreateMemberType() local 3524 DBuilder.createMemberType(Unit, Name, Unit, 0, FieldSize, FieldAlign, in CreateMemberType() 4181 uint32_t FieldAlign; in EmitTypeForVarWithBlocksAttr() local 4231 FieldAlign = CGM.getContext().toBits(Align); in EmitTypeForVarWithBlocksAttr() 4235 Unit, VD->getName(), Unit, 0, FieldSize, FieldAlign, FieldOffset, in EmitTypeForVarWithBlocksAttr() 4343 auto FieldAlign = getDeclAlignIfRequired(Field, CGM.getContext()); in EmitDeclare() local [all …]
|